My TomTom sat nav is ancient. Ill probably still use it as I like it but more and more I use google maps on my phone. There seems to be loads of phone holders online but can anyone recommend one thats good for the motorhome? One that rotates so you can view in landscape.
I've been using three Vanmass phone holders in 3 different vehicles for last couple of years and they're excellent. screen or dash options for fitting, completely secure grip on phone, portrait or landscape orientation. Initially I was sceptical about how well it'd stick to the windscreen, having tried others in the past, but these fix very securely and won't budge or wobble at all even when screen is hot.
